#[non_exhaustive]
pub struct CreateActivationInputBuilder { /* private fields */ }
Expand description

A builder for CreateActivationInput.

Implementations§

source§

impl CreateActivationInputBuilder

source

pub fn description(self, input: impl Into<String>) -> Self

A user-defined description of the resource that you want to register with Systems Manager.

Don't enter personally identifiable information in this field.

source

pub fn default_instance_name(self, input: impl Into<String>) -> Self

The name of the registered, managed node as it will appear in the Amazon Web Services Systems Manager console or when you use the Amazon Web Services command line tools to list Systems Manager resources.

Don't enter personally identifiable information in this field.

source

pub fn iam_role(self, input: impl Into<String>) -> Self

The name of the Identity and Access Management (IAM) role that you want to assign to the managed node. This IAM role must provide AssumeRole permissions for the Amazon Web Services Systems Manager service principal ssm.amazonaws.com. For more information, see Create an IAM service role for a hybrid and multicloud environment in the Amazon Web Services Systems Manager User Guide.

You can't specify an IAM service-linked role for this parameter. You must create a unique role.

This field is required.

source

pub fn registration_limit(self, input: i32) -> Self

Specify the maximum number of managed nodes you want to register. The default value is 1.

source

pub fn expiration_date(self, input: DateTime) -> Self

The date by which this activation request should expire, in timestamp format, such as "2021-07-07T00:00:00". You can specify a date up to 30 days in advance. If you don't provide an expiration date, the activation code expires in 24 hours.

source

pub fn tags(self, input: Tag) -> Self

Appends an item to tags.

To override the contents of this collection use set_tags.

Optional metadata that you assign to a resource. Tags enable you to categorize a resource in different ways, such as by purpose, owner, or environment. For example, you might want to tag an activation to identify which servers or virtual machines (VMs) in your on-premises environment you intend to activate. In this case, you could specify the following key-value pairs:

  • Key=OS,Value=Windows

  • Key=Environment,Value=Production

When you install SSM Agent on your on-premises servers and VMs, you specify an activation ID and code. When you specify the activation ID and code, tags assigned to the activation are automatically applied to the on-premises servers or VMs.

You can't add tags to or delete tags from an existing activation. You can tag your on-premises servers, edge devices, and VMs after they connect to Systems Manager for the first time and are assigned a managed node ID. This means they are listed in the Amazon Web Services Systems Manager console with an ID that is prefixed with "mi-". For information about how to add tags to your managed nodes, see AddTagsToResource. For information about how to remove tags from your managed nodes, see RemoveTagsFromResource.
